Gametype Idea: War (12 vs 12)

Sorry about the lame name of my gametype idea but whatever. The basic idea is that we have a 24 player gametype that allows a great mix of vehicular and infantry combat.

Gametype:
The gametype would be a mix of CTF, Assault, and Territories. Each team is tasked with either taking the enemy’s flag, planting a bomb at the enemy’s base, or holding the territory in the enemy base. It would allow for an increasingly dynamic match, where at one point the enemy may be trying to steal your flag or plant a bomb, or they may even be doing those two things at the same time. The match would be won when 2 of the 3 objectives are completed or the time runs out. Additionally, if need be, several territories littered between bases can be placed to encourage map flow and additional points. Furthermore, the gametype can be made as UNSC vs Covenant/main antagonist for vehicle/weapon variety (like Invasion) or just plain old UNSC vs UNSC or Covies vs Covies.

The idea is to give a “realistic” feel in one gametype with encouraged teamwork and realistic wartime scenarios, hence the name “War.”

Maps: The maps in the game would be set up similar to current CTF maps, but less linear with multiple paths to take, which also will increase the dynamic feel of the gametype (at one point enemies will attack from one side, then the other, or both at the same time.) Each base has a main structure which holds the objectives at different places inside of it. There is also a secondary “outpost” type base which is where the team will spawn if the enemy is inside the main structure.

Spawning: At the start of the match, half of the players will spawn at the main structure and half at the outpost (both base structures will contain and equal number and type of vehicles.) The reason for the splitting is to help set up an initial strategy and reduce player crowding in one place.

Vehicles: Vehicles would have to be implemented in a way the with all vehicles filled at the same time (excluding passengers) there should still be 3+ infantry. Vehicle respawn times would also be staggered. For example, if there are two warthogs per team, one would respawn at say, 60 seconds, and the other at 100 or 120. Obviously, more powerful vehicles would have longer respawn times than others. Vehicle sets would include:
-transports (mongooses/equivilent/multi-person)
-recon (warthogs/equivilent)
-heavy (tank/equivilent)
-air (attack transport and transport dropship)
-artillery (stationed turrets/cannons)
-amphibious/aquatic vehicles depending on map
